This CL runs a second round of constant propagation after range
analysis to eliminate additional unreachable code. Range analysis
is changed to mark branches as constant if the constraints they
generate are unsatisfiable.
The second pass of constant propagation only visits branches and
removes unreachable code, but does not do full constant propagation.
This proves useful when inlining array view operations where the
following pattern occurs:
for (i = 0; i < length; i++) {
if (i < 0 || i >= length) {
throw 123;
}
foo();
}
In this example the if-statement will be eliminated completely.
Also, fix a bug in range analyis where constraints of already
constrained values were missing.

Split it into three phases: initialization, widening and narrowing.
During widening and narrowing phi-ranges change according to classical widening and narrowing operators defined as:
Widening:
[_|_, _|_] v [a, b] = [a, b]
[a, b] v [c, d] = [c < a ? -inf : a, d > b ? +inf : b]
Narrowing:
[a, b] ^ [c, d] = [(a == -inf) ? c : min(a, c), (b == +inf) ? d : max(b, d)]
